Philip J Solondz Family Foundation
The Philip J Solondz Family Foundation is a private foundation based in Millburn, New Jersey, designated as a 501(c)(3) organization. The foundation has been tax-exempt since August 1991. It operates as a grantmaking foundation with a focus on supporting charitable organizations through unrestricted grants.

Mission & Focus Areas
The foundation primarily funds unrestricted grants to support organizations' charitable purposes. Its grantmaking focuses on Education, Philanthropy, Voluntarism & Grantmaking, and Human Services, with a geographic emphasis on New York, New Jersey, and the District of Columbia.

Financial History
Multi-year comparison from IRS filings
As of December 2024:
- Total Assets: $6,546,822
- Total Revenue: $684,400
- Total Expenses: $558,134
- Net Income: $126,266
- Total Liabilities: $0
- Total Giving: $309,561
- Number of Employees: 1
Revenue Composition (2024):
- Investment income and dividends: $190,621
The foundation maintains a healthy financial position with no liabilities and substantial assets relative to its annual giving.
